Asbestos roof removal vs asbestos encapsulation is a crucial determination for homeowners and building managers facing the dangers associated with asbestos in older structures. Asbestos was a widely used material as a outcome of its sturdiness and fireplace resistance, but its health hazards have prompted regulations and administration methods to minimize exposure.


Removal involves taking out any asbestos-containing materials from a structure completely. This technique can appear to be an easy answer, particularly for those who prioritize fully eliminating the risk of asbestos exposure. However, the process is complicated and often disruptive. It requires the experience of pros who concentrate on asbestos abatement to guarantee that the material is removed safely.


Encapsulation, then again, entails sealing the asbestos material to forestall fibers from turning into airborne. This methodology is usually chosen for its cost-effectiveness and less intrusive nature (Cost-effective Asbestos Roof Removal). It can permit for continued use of the constructing while minimizing danger, provided that the encapsulated areas are frequently monitored and maintained.


Both methods have their advantages and disadvantages. Removal ensures that there isn't any remaining threat of asbestos exposure, which is often a important concern for people working or dwelling in the construction. However, the method can be lengthy and will require momentary relocation for occupants, as well as cautious disposal of the asbestos material.

Encapsulation can be completed extra shortly and sometimes with out the necessity for vacating the house, making it appealing to many building house owners. The initial prices are sometimes decrease in comparability with whole removal, nevertheless it requires ongoing inspections to make sure the integrity of the seal. If the encapsulating material degrades or is broken, the asbestos may turn out to be a hazard again.


Regulatory concerns also play a substantial position in the choice between these two approaches. Local health and safety regulations typically dictate the required methods for asbestos administration, together with whether removal or encapsulation is more applicable for a given state of affairs. Consulting with licensed professionals who understand the legal landscape ensures a compliant method.

Many elements affect the selection between removal and encapsulation. The situation of the asbestos-containing material is probably considered one of the most important. If the asbestos is in good situation, encapsulation might be sensible. However, whether it is friable or deteriorating, removal could be the only secure choice.


Building usage is one other important facet to assume about. For structures repeatedly occupied, like faculties or hospitals, the added precaution of removal might be needed to make sure occupant safety. For less incessantly used buildings, encapsulation may suffice, permitting the property to remain practical with out significant disruption.

Financial implications naturally weigh closely on this determination - DIY Safe Asbestos Removal. Removal incurs greater upfront costs due to labor, disposal, and compliance with safety regulations. In distinction, encapsulation can be extra inexpensive initially. Still, ongoing maintenance and checks should be budgeted for, which can offset any financial savings.


It's vital to do not neglect that neither method ensures absolute security without correct oversight and upkeep. Encapsulated materials should be inspected routinely to confirm that the encapsulation is unbroken and efficient. If any signs of wear, degradation, or harm appear, a licensed professional should evaluate the state of affairs instantly.

Conversely, as soon as removed, the area should be managed appropriately to forestall future asbestos exposure. Ensuring that the space is free from contamination is paramount, together with the correct handling of any materials that may have come into contact with asbestos in the course of the removal course of.


In contemplating the long-term implications, encapsulation could present a suitable solution in particular situations, especially the place budgets are tight and quick removal isn’t realistic. However, planning for future prices related to inspections and potential repairs should factor into the overall monetary strategy.


The health dangers associated with asbestos can by no means be taken frivolously. No matter the visit this site right here tactic chosen, educating occupants about the potential risks and protected practices in coping with environments which will contain asbestos is crucial. This knowledge is important for ensuring that risks are minimized and managed successfully.

Is asbestos encapsulation a safe option?undefinedYes, encapsulation is taken into account protected when performed accurately by certified professionals. It can effectively isolate asbestos, stopping exposure, although it requires common monitoring and maintenance to make sure long-term effectiveness.


How long does the asbestos roof removal course of take?undefinedThe period of asbestos roof removal can range relying on the size of the roof and the extent of asbestos current. Generally, the process can take a few days to every week, together with safety assessments and cleanup.
